Dr Sketchy's Brisbane - September 2011

The beautiful, the stunning Lila Luxx...

...I'm not overly happy with these preliminary sketches, they don't look quite right.

The following ones are better. I tried working on a tinted background this time. The white highlights are done with liquid paper. This approach is kinda derivative of cartoonist/good girl artist Bill Ward...

And, a face!...
... Not the best face (Lila's face is far prettier than this), but a face nonetheless!
 

There was a 15 minute pose that we finished off with, but my sketch didn't hold up, so I won't bother posting it. The proportions were wrong, and the second face I attempted this night looked dreadful. There's little room for error when working with no pencil or eraser, that's the downside of ink.
